As Wedding Know How editors, we write about issues that we love and we predict you will like too.<br>Also known as a boatneck, the bateau neckline stops at your collarbone and contains a wider opening that skims the tops of your shoulders, allowing your décolletage to shine. This neckline is extraordinarily traditional and demure, and it is also a royal favorite—the Duchess of Sussex opted for a sublime bateau neckline paired with lengthy sleeves for her walk down the aisle. Like the name, this neckline sits just under the shoulders to showcase the décolletage. Off-the-shoulder necklines make for beautiful bridal portraits and is flattering on nearly all physique varieties. You do not need to spend 1,000,000 bucks to get the right robe. Besides having sale racks, many salons maintain massive gross sales a couple of times a 12 months to clear out "gently worn" or discontinued samples . To find out when these are, call shops, go to designers' web sites, and sign up for mailing lists. In addition to the URL, the meta title and meta description are two issues that are visible to the person on a search engine results page before they click on on a outcome. For this cause, a well-written meta title and outline can be the difference between getting a click on and never getting a click. According to Moz, solely 5.59% of clicks are from page two or three. The first 5 results account for 67.60% of all clicks, and 71.33% of searches end in a web page one natural cl
